Is 1.5 hours enough to land in Athens from NYC and transfer to Naxos flight? by cookieguggleman in GreeceTravel

[–]nickstef13 0 points1 point  (0 children)

No! Thought 3 hours was enough to land and get on sky express to Santorini. Immigrations was crazy! Missed that flight and had to pay for another since there is no changes allowed before 3 hours from take off! I would give yourself at least a 4 hour window or get insurance on your ticket better be safe then sorry.

Rust on the door hinges, replace the bushings? by [deleted] in Wrangler

[–]nickstef13 0 points1 point  (0 children)

No very easy to replace the bushings most kits come with a little insert to bang them out from the bottom. You can also use a socket. Once you pop them out clean the hinge holes well before installing the plastic ones. You may have to sand down the hinge pin if it’s bad. I also put some waterproof grease in the new bushings to help prevent them from seizing. Very easy to do.

Rust on the door hinges, replace the bushings? by [deleted] in Wrangler

[–]nickstef13 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Replace the bushings in general yes, but it won’t fix the rust. The rust is under the paint. I had mine repainted under warranty a few years ago. The corrosion warranty only lasts 5 years or 100k miles though. After repainting get plastic bushings to prevent rust. Poor design from the factory.

Gotta love Long Island by nickstef13 in Jeep

[–]nickstef13[S] 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Yes if you live in Suffolk county there is a 4x4 recreational permit that gives you access to about 10 or so county parks. Not sure about Nassau (if that's where you live). And then there are state permits that allow you access to Robert Moses and A few other state parks. Here's a link
